Grade A1 Incombustible Materials Glasswool Ceiling Insulation Board:

Glass wool is a category in glass fiber, an artificial inorganic fiber. Using quartz sand, limestone, and dolomite as main raw materials, it is blown into a flocculent fine fiber in a molten state. The three-dimensional cross-intertwined fibers create numerous small gaps, providing excellent insulation and sound absorption performance.
